Responsibilities included pre-construction pricing and budgeting, development services as well as consultant coordination and management. Commercial projects ranged in value from $20m - $180m.

Site evaluation: existing utilities, structures, restrictions, traffic issues.

Established Consultant pool, selected qualified bidders, issued RFP to selected bidders, created matrix for selection based upon bid submittals, negotiated final contract with selected bidders.

Coordination with City of Houston planners, fire marshals and traffic departments for approvals.

Established General Contractor pool and selected qualified bidders, negotiated final contract and selected Contractors. Negotiated fee and general conditions including pre-construction activities.

Management of consultants and contractors through the design development and construction document phases including documents and specifications. Scheduled and managed weekly project meetings with all consultants as well as other design meetings as required.

Conducted meetings with utility companies and City regarding required capacity for project gas, electrical, phone and sewer facilities.

Provided monthly formal reports to Owner and lenders. Provided constant interface with Owner as project proceeded. In conjunction with the Owner, established requirements for general contractor insurance and bond requirements.

Management of general contractors proposed schedule, based upon established milestone dates and creation and management of project budgets, and construction cost budgets from concept through final design to minimize scope creep and cost overruns.

Established and managed an administrative process for change orders, and schedule extensions for contractor and consultants.

Provided a single source contact for contractor and consultants to resolve conflicting design issues or coordination issues.

Established process and format for contractor and consultant progress billing. Reviewed and approved all progress billing from contractor and consultants and submitted to accounting for payment. Required accurate and current billing with all necessary backup information, lien releases, insurance certificates, etc.

Operated as liaison coordinating the City of Houston, Program Manager Parsons-Brinkerhoff, and Continental Airlines as stakeholders. Responsibilities involved front-line, day-to-day interface with more than 50 inter-related individuals with differing objectives and responsibilities. Efforts, responsibilities, and goals were focused on the joint success of the International Services Expansion Program at the Houston Intercontinental Airport encompassing over 10 distinct but inter-related construction projects with a combined value in excess of $ 500 million.

Located in the project office of the City of Houston program manager, Parsons-Brinkerhoff, in order to monitor, evaluate and report on the personnel, process and costs associated with the ISEP program at the airport. Continental was responsible for 75% of the ISEP costs so they had a vested interest in the efficient use of personnel, project efficiency and ultimately the hard and soft design and construction costs.

Attended weekly project meetings on each of the ISEP projects and made suggestions regarding the design process, project personnel and project costs and change orders.

Reviewed the site work in progress for consistency, quality and adequate personnel.

Recommended that certain project personnel be replaced due to lack of capability and technical skill and that other positions be eliminated due to redundancy or personnel creep.

Provided input and comment at monthly ISEP meeting with Continental senior management, City of Houston Airport senior management, and senior ISEP Program management.

Reviewed and commented upon ISEP change orders relative to cost, schedule and validity for contractors, sub-contractors and consultants.

Worked with City of Houston management to streamline the design and costs of changes as well as working toward a final completion of all projects.

Parque Industrial project in Queretaro, Mexico. $30m. 600 acres.

oCreated an industrial and distribution park that was originally a corn field. This required the design, construction, and implementation of all new electrical substation facilities, new water wells, new roads and fire loop, new waste water treatment plant, new civil drainage plan including an 8 foot diameter drainage pipe under the existing highway, new bridges, rail spur from main line 5 miles away, and a new highway by-pass.

oUtilized a US consulting civil engineer along with the owner’s own Mexican civil engineers.
